Hi Bummer - it's really hard to say because everybody heals differently. In my case the swelling started to go down after the first week, and has been diminishing rapidly ever since (I'm 19 days post-p now). The bleeding stopped after the first week (KOW). Even so, the skin tag site is still not completely healed and still gets irritated easily. For some people here, the skin tag took 3-4 months to heal. A lot depends on the location of the skin tag and how well you heal. Some folks found a special cream that really helped (sufrexal, I think it's called) - but you can only get it in Mexico and other Latin American countries, I believe.
I'm really sorry you are suffering! As long as there is no infection, you are fine. Just be prepared for things to be pretty tender there for a good while. I'm sorry to say that, but I also don't want you to worry if you aren't healed up quickly, because that rarely happens with skin tags. Hang in there, though, the pain and swelling will diminish soon!
